Fastening of the Drill Rig
The diamond core drill ESD 200 may only be used mounted on a drill rig.
Since the drill rig is not included in the delivery, we point out some
important kinds of assembly.
For this purpose, please refer to the drill rig's operating instructions.
The most common way of fastening is dowel fixing.
If possible, use metal dowels only. The dowel diameter must not be
smaller than 12 mm.
In order to fasten the drilling unit correctly, you need the fastening set
(order number 35720000).
Drill a hole with a diameter of 16 mm, 50 mm deep. Make sure that
the hole is free of dust.
Insert a dowel and open it with an expanding mandrel.
Screw the thread rod into the dowel.
Put the drilling unit with the deep hole in the base onto the thread rod.
Place the washer and screw the butterfly nut tightly.
Adjust the drilling unit by means of the four screws in the foot plate
and tighten the wing nut firmly with an open-end spanner (SW27)
after adjustment.
Vertical drilling
Switch on the PRCD switch.
Switch the motor on without touching the surface with the drill bit.
Turn the handle to bring down the drill bit until it contacts the surface.
In order to reach an exact centring of the drill bit, keep the feed low
for the first centimeter of cutting depth.
Then you can drill faster. A too small drilling speed reduces the
power. On the other hand, when the drilling speed is too high, the
diamond segments quickly become blunt.
Angular drilling
Remove the screw in the foot base which arrests the column at 90°.
Loosen the two screws on the base of the column and turn the
column to the requested angle.
Retighten the screws again.
At the beginning, it is better to drill very slowy because the bit only
meshes with a fraction of its cutting area with the material. If you drill
too fast or with a pressure which is too high, the bit can be off centre.
You have hit reinforced iron when you recognise while drilling that the feed
rate gets very low, when you need to use more force.
